Only two APIs are provided: the IAdapterService and its facade extension method As in the Adapters type. You can chose to use the former service directly instead of the convenience extension method. You don't lose any testability in doing either way, although you do need to pass around the adapter service in one case. ======= Example ======= // Calling code assumes there is a service always setup before invoking. // If there isn't, an InvalidOperationException is thrown automatically. // Use adapter extension method As as needed, i.e. // say we need to use it as an MSBuild project, if possible IMSBuildProject msbuild = project.As<IMSBuildProject>(); if (msbuild != null) // do MSBuild stuff with it.
